/*Elements*/
HTML
{
}
BODY
{
	background: #000;
	color: #CCC;
	font-family: Arial, Verdana, sans-serif;
	font-size: 11px;
}
*
{
	margin: 0;
	padding: 0;
}
HR
{
	display: none;
}
H1
{
	padding-bottom: 13px;
}
H2
{
	margin-bottom: 15px;
	margin-top: 0px;
	/*[empty]border-top:;*/
}
H3
{
	padding: 0;
}
P
{
	margin: 0 0 15px;
}
A
{
	color: #014392;
	text-decoration: none;
}
A:hover
{
	text-decoration: underline;
}
UL
{
	margin: 0 0 15px;
	list-style: inside;
}
LI
{
}
IMG
{
	padding-bottom: 6px;
	border: none;
}
TABLE
{
	margin: 0 auto;
}
TD
{
	vertical-align: top;
	padding-bottom: 7px;
}
TR
{
}
/*Classes*/
.clear
{
	clear: both;
}
.image-right
{
	float: right;
	margin: 0px 10px;
}
.image-left
{
	float: left;
	margin: 0px 12px 0px 4px;
}
.caption
{
	font-style: italic;
	text-align: center;
	margin-top: -6px;
	color: #9D9A9A;
}
.year
{
	font-weight: bold;
	width: 83px;
}
.center
{
	text-align: center;
}
P.artist
{
	padding-top: 6px;
	margin-bottom: 28px;
	/*[empty]margin-top:;*/
}
.invisible
{
	display: none;
}
/*Pages*/
#home #slideshow
{
	margin-right: 17px;
	margin-top: 3px;
	margin-left: 0;
}
#matt-cooley #scroll-box
{
	/* [disabled]overflow-y:scroll;*/
}
#miss-polly #scroll-box
{
	/* [disabled]overflow-y:scroll;*/
}
#about-us #scroll-box P
{
	margin-bottom: 0px;
}
/*Containers*/
#container
{
	width: 898px;
	margin: 45px auto 0;
	height: 496px;
	border: 1px solid #575654;
	background-color: #000;
	background-image: url(images/container-bg.jpg);
	background-repeat: no-repeat;
	background-position: right top;
}
/*Navigation*/
#navigation
{
	float: left;
	margin: 12px 14px 0px 0px;
	background: url(images/nav-bg.jpg) no-repeat bottom left;
	height: 484px;
	width: 275px;
}
#navigation H1 SPAN
{
	display: none;
}
#navigation H1
{
	width: 281px;
	height: 89px;
	background: url(images/blue-blood.jpg);
	margin-left: 6px;
	margin-top: 10px;
	padding-bottom: 0;
}
#navigation UL
{
	list-style-type: none;
	list-style-position: outside;
	margin-left: 27px;
	margin-top: 40px;
}
#navigation UL LI
{
}
#navigation UL LI A
{
	display: block;
	margin-bottom: 8px;
}
#navigation UL LI A SPAN
{
	display: none;
}
#navigation UL LI A.home
{
	width: 66px;
	height: 34px;
	background: url(images/button-home.gif) no-repeat top left;
}
#navigation UL LI A.about-us
{
	width: 106px;
	height: 34px;
	background: url(images/button-about-us.gif) no-repeat top left;
}
#navigation UL LI A.matt-cooley
{
	width: 137px;
	height: 34px;
	background: url(images/button-matt-cooley.gif) no-repeat top left;
}
#navigation UL LI A.miss-polly
{
	width: 131px;
	height: 34px;
	background: url(images/button-miss-polly.gif) no-repeat top left;
}
#navigation UL LI A.shaun-bailey
{
	width: 156px;
	height: 34px;
	background: url(images/button-shaun-bailey.gif) no-repeat top left;
}
#navigation UL LI A.art {
	width: 66px;
	height: 34px;
	background-image: url(images/button-art.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
#navigation UL LI A.blog {
	width: 66px;
	height: 34px;
	background-image: url(images/blog.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
#navigation UL LI A.contact
{
	width: 84px;
	height: 25px;
	background: url(images/button-contact.gif) no-repeat top left;
}
#navigation UL LI A.active, #navigation UL LI A:hover
{
	background-position: 0px -34px;
}
/*Thumbnails*/
#thumbnails
{
	width: 73px;
	float: right;
	margin-top: -380px;
	margin-left: 15px;
	background: #000;
	text-align: center;
	margin-right: -4px;
}
#thumbnails #thumbs
{
	height: 318px;
	overflow: hidden;
}
#thumbnails A IMG
{
	opacity: 0.7;
	filter: alpha(opacity = 70);
	outline: 0 solid #000;
	border: 1px solid #000;
	padding: 0;
	margin-bottom: 6px;
}
#thumbnails A:hover IMG, #thumbnails A.active IMG
{
	opacity: 1;
	filter: alpha(opacity = 100);
	border: 1px solid #FFF;
}
/*Scroll Box*/
#scroll-box
{
	width: 570px;
	height: 449px;
	border: 1px solid #575654;
	float: right;
	margin: 22px 25px 19px 0px;
	padding: 0px;
	overflow-y: hidden;
	overflow-x: hidden;
	background: #000;
	position: relative;
}
#vid-box {
	border: 1px solid #575654;
	float: right;
	margin: 22px 25px 19px 0px;
	padding: 0px;
	overflow-y: hidden;
	overflow-x: hidden;
	background: #000;
}
#scroll-box #left
{
	width: 304px;
	float: left;
	margin-left: 30px;
	margin-top: 25px;
}
#scroll-box #right
{
	float: right;
	margin-right: 16px;
	margin-top: 24px;
}
#scroll-box #single
{
	width: 520px;
	float: left;
	margin-left: 30px;
	margin-top: 25px;
	line-height: 12px;
}
#scroll-box #single P
{
	margin-bottom: 14px;
}
#about-us #scroll-box P
{
	margin-bottom: 11px;
}
#scroll-box #gallery
{
	text-align: center;
}
#scroll-box #gallery IMG
{
	margin-top: auto;
}
/*Loading*/
#loading
{
	position: absolute;
	text-align: center;
	right: 158px;
	top: 140px;
	background: #000 url(images/loading.gif) no-repeat center bottom;
	padding-bottom: 31px;
	width: 100px;
}
/*Slideshow*/
#slideshow
{
	list-style-type: none;
	width: 186px;
	height: 169px;
	float: right;
	margin-left: 17px;
}
/*Heading Replacers*/
#home #scroll-box H1 SPAN
{
	display: none;
}
#home #scroll-box H1
{
	width: 72px;
	height: 26px;
	background: url(images/h-home.gif) no-repeat top left;
}
#home #scroll-box H2 SPAN
{
	display: none;
}
#home #scroll-box H2
{
	width: 95px;
	height: 19px;
	background: url(images/h-our-artists.gif) no-repeat top left;
	border-top: 6px solid #000000;
	margin-bottom: 19px;
}
#about-us #scroll-box H1 SPAN
{
	display: none;
}
#about-us #scroll-box H1
{
	width: 116px;
	height: 26px;
	background: url(images/h-about-us.gif);
	padding-bottom: 0;
	margin-bottom: 15px;
}
#contact #scroll-box H1 SPAN
{
	display: none;
}
#contact #scroll-box H1
{
	width: 93px;
	height: 26px;
	background: url(images/h-contact.gif);
	padding-bottom: 0;
	margin-bottom: 15px;
}
/*Footer*/
#footer
{
	text-align: right;
	width: 900px;
	margin: 0 auto;
	margin-top: 8px;
}
#footer A
{
	color: #949391;
	text-decoration: none;
}
#footer A:hover
{
	color: #CCC;
	text-decoration: underline;
}
#scroll-box-art {
	width: 424px;
	height: 334px;
	float: right;
	padding: 0px;
	overflow-y: hidden;
	overflow-x: hidden;
	position: relative;
	background-image: none;
	border-top-style: none;
	border-right-style: none;
	border-bottom-style: none;
	border-left-style: none;
	background-repeat: no-repeat;
	margin-top: 81px;
	margin-right: 76px;
	margin-bottom: 0px;
	margin-left: 0px;
}
#container-art {
	width: 898px;
	height: 496px;
	border: 1px solid #575654;
	background-color: #000;
	background-image: url(images/art_images_large/frame.jpg);
	background-repeat: no-repeat;
	background-position: right center;
	margin-top: 45px;
	margin-right: auto;
	margin-bottom: 0;
	margin-left: auto;
}

